Orbital inflammatory pseudotumor associated with multifocal systemic neoplastic immunoincompetence

Summary
This case highlights eosinophilic granuloma within an orbital pseudotumor, linked to multifocal tumor immunoincompetence. The patient later developed lymphoma and glioblastoma, underscoring rare immune system dysregulation.
Area of Science:
- Ophthalmology
- Oncology
- Immunology
Background:
- Orbital pseudotumors are inflammatory lesions of unknown etiology.
- Eosinophilic granuloma is a histiocytic disorder characterized by Langerhans' cell proliferation.
Observation:
- A 52-year-old man presented with proptosis due to an orbital mass initially diagnosed as inflammatory orbital pseudotumor.
- The lesion persisted despite corticosteroid treatment, and a second biopsy revealed eosinophilic granuloma.
- The patient subsequently developed soft palate lymphoma and glioblastoma multiforme.
Findings:
- This case is the first report of multifocal tumor immunoincompetence associated with eosinophilic granuloma in an orbital inflammatory pseudotumor.
- The findings suggest a potential link between eosinophilic granuloma, immune dysregulation, and the development of multiple malignancies.
Implications:
- This case expands the understanding of the spectrum of histiocytic disorders and their potential systemic implications.
- Further research is warranted to explore the relationship between eosinophilic granuloma, immune dysfunction, and oncogenesis.
